Built in Double Oven and Microwave

A built in double oven and microwave is a great option for kitchens of those who host. This appliance allows you to cook multi-rack for holiday gatherings or make cooking easier for everyday.
They are usually available in 30-inch and 24-inch models. They have a variety of features like apps that work with them and LED status bars.
Convenience
Double ovens can be a game changer for anyone with kids who love cooking or hosts guests. They are also ideal for small food establishments. You can cook two meals at once at different temperatures using an oven that doubles, whether it's an oven that is wall-mounted or a microwave/oven combo unit. This makes it simpler to serve your guests and family.
There are many double ovens that come with advanced features, which make them more efficient. Some double ovens come with advanced features, such as sous vide technology, air-frying and steam-burst features. They are ideal for home cooks who want to improve their cooking skills or entertain guests with delicious food. Other options include a warming drawer to keep food hot until serving, and pyrolytic cleaning that cleans up any baked-on spills and messes with the touch of one button.
Oven microwave combos offer the same convenience as a double oven but with a smaller space. They're also often positioned higher than standalone units, which means you don't have to sit or bend down to lift heavy roasts or baking pans into and out of the oven. These models are also generally more attractive than standalone appliances and come with a range of safety features, including automatic shut-off to avoid overheating.
There are many advantages to having double ovens but it's important to take into consideration your budget and needs prior to installing this luxuries appliance. The cost of a double oven may be more than twice the cost of a single oven, and it might require professional installation to ensure that you have enough space to set up. If you're looking for ways to save counter space in your kitchen, think about a built-in microwave and double oven that is recessed into the wall instead of being on the counter. This kind of installation requires the assistance of a professional to ensure the space is properly reinforced before installing the oven and microwave.
You can also install an appliance under your counter or within the cabinet above your stove. Hidden microwaves do not provide more counter space but it can make your kitchen appear more sleek and tidy. Certain models let you place the microwave in the form of a drawer to give it a more custom look. Drawer-style units are safe for everyone, and require less maintenance. It is recommended to avoid placing the microwave near windows, as this could restrict the airflow and cause it to overheat.
